Solution for 5(u+8)=-5u-20 equation:


Simplifying
5(u + 8) = -5u + -20

Reorder the terms:
5(8 + u) = -5u + -20
(8 * 5 + u * 5) = -5u + -20
(40 + 5u) = -5u + -20

Reorder the terms:
40 + 5u = -20 + -5u

Solving
40 + 5u = -20 + -5u

Solving for variable 'u'.

Move all terms containing u to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'5u' to each side of the equation.
40 + 5u + 5u = -20 + -5u + 5u

Combine like terms: 5u + 5u = 10u
40 + 10u = -20 + -5u + 5u

Combine like terms: -5u + 5u = 0
40 + 10u = -20 + 0
40 + 10u = -20

Add '-40' to each side of the equation.
40 + -40 + 10u = -20 + -40

Combine like terms: 40 + -40 = 0
0 + 10u = -20 + -40
10u = -20 + -40

Combine like terms: -20 + -40 = -60
10u = -60

Divide each side by '10'.
u = -6

Simplifying
u = -6
